WebFeb 18, 2024 · Currently, Alaska holds the most serious penalty for cell phone use violations. In Alaska, the first violation fine for texting while driving is $500, but if the cell phone use causes serious injuries or death, the driver can face a felony conviction and a fine increase of up to $250,000. WebAlthough all kinds of distractions can affect safety adversely, talking and texting on a cell phone while driving have emerged as two of the most dangerous forms of distracted driving. Text messaging is particularly hazardous because it involves all three types of distraction -- visual, manual, and cognitive -- and it is an increasingly common ...
